re: exhuast bolts/nuts



 
>     What's a good type of bolt and nut to use on an exhaust system
> (mufflers, specifically) if you want to have some realistic expectation of
> unscrewing the bolt at some later date, after rust has set in?  Stainless
> steel perhaps?  Or is it good to use low-grade steel that would be easy to
> shear off or chisel off after it's rusted.  I've already got some 8-mm
> grade eight bolts (medium carbon, alloy steel, quenched and tempered) plus
> bronze nuts, but was wondering if something else would be a better choice.

	For my money, Stainless Steel is the way to go.  Tried regular bolts
with anti-sieze, with bronze nuts and nothing beats good old SS.
